Iowa Wild (12-4-3-1; 28 pts.) at Colorado Eagles (9-7-3-0, 21 pts.)

For the first time in franchise history, Iowa heads to the Budweiser Events Center to take on the Colorado Eagles in Loveland, Colo. The two-game series will the final two times the Wild and the Eagles battle in the regular season. Iowa sits in second place in the Central Division while Colorado is in third in the Pacific.

Last Game

Iowa earned a point against the Grand Rapids Griffins as the team fell in overtime by a score of 3-2 Monday night. Forwards Gerry Mayhew and Cal O’Reilly recorded the goals for the Wild while goaltender Kaapo Kahkonen stopped 34 of 37 shots in the contest.

WILD Notables

  • Iowa heads to Colorado sporting a seven-game road point streak, tied for the longest in the AHL this season.
  • The Wild is just one of two teams to have not lost by more than two goals so far this season (other: Laval).
  • Iowa has scored first in 14 games this season, which leads the AHL.
  • The Wild is the only team in the league to have a top-five ranked power play and penalty kill.

EAGLES Notables

  • Colorado defeated the San Jose Barracuda in the shootout by a score of 4-3 on Nov. 24.
  • Forward Andrew Agozzino paces the Eagles with 20 points (9g, 11) in 19 games for Colorado.
  • Colorado’s 55 shots against Iowa on Oct. 26 is the most shots in a single game this season across the AHL.
  • Former Minnesota Wild draft pick Justin Falk is in his first season with the Eagles, posting two points (1g, 1a) in eight games.
